Notes on LTO Cells

  • The optimal operating range of the YINLONG LTO cells is between 2.0V and 2.5V.
  • When charging the cells above 2.5V, the voltage increases more sharply, and above 2.6V it increases very sharply. The same applies when discharging below 2.0V!
  • Therefore, the use of a good active balancer for LTO cells that are connected in series is also very important.
  • "If very large currents (charging or discharging) are used, it may be necessary to further restrict the working area to avoid strong voltage spikes or drops."

Difference between: LTO - LiFePO4 Lithium batteries

  • Lithium Titanate Cells (LTO)
    • + extremely long lifespan
    • + 10x higher cycle life than LiFePO4 cells
    • + extremely safe
    • + very high charge and discharge currents possible (5C-10C)
    • + less temperature-sensitive, can also be charged at <0°C
    • + now affordable, cells have become cheaper
    • + very high calendar lifespan (>25 years)
    • - LTO is more expensive than LiFePO4
    • - higher weight or less capacity
    • - lower cell voltage (2.3V), therefore more cells needed for the same battery voltage
  • Lithium Iron Phosphate Cells (LiFePO4)
    • + cheaper price
    • + large variety of capacities and sizes
    • + higher capacity
    • + higher cell voltage (3.2V), fewer cells needed
    • - shorter lifespan
    • - not quite as secure as LTO
    • - max. charging or discharging currents are significantly lower (2C-3C)

Welche Besonderheiten gibt es bei der LTO Zellenspannung?

The features of the LTO cell voltage from GS Audio include minimum discharge cut-off voltages of 1.8V to 2.0V and charge cut-off voltages of 2.5V to 2.65V. Users should note that the cells must be sensitized when discharging below 2.0V or charging above 2.5V, as voltage changes occur more rapidly. A high-quality active balancer is recommended for cells connected in series. Optimal voltage levels ensure not only longevity but also the best possible performance and efficiency of the cells in various applications.

Wann ist die Verwendung eines aktiven Balancers wichtig?

An active balancer is essential for the LTO cells from GS Audio when they are connected in series. The cells have a specific voltage of 2.0V to 2.5V, with voltage deviations outside this range potentially affecting their lifespan. The balancer prevents unequal charge states and stabilizes the cells, leading to a longer lifespan. Especially at high charge and discharge currents, unexpected voltage fluctuations can occur, which are efficiently balanced by the balancer.

Welche Unterschiede bestehen zwischen LTO und LiFePO4 Zellen?

LTO cells, like those from GS Audio, differ significantly from LiFePO4 cells in several respects. They offer an extremely long lifespan and up to 10 times higher cycle life. LTO is also safer and supports high charge and discharge currents of 5C-10C. Furthermore, they are less temperature-sensitive and have a higher calendar life. In contrast, LiFePO4 cells are equipped with a higher cell voltage of 3.2V and are typically cheaper with a wider variety of available sizes.
